US, Partners Conduct More Airstrikes in Iraq and Syria
Published at(BAGHDAD, Iraq) — U.S. and international military forces conducted more airstrikes in Iraq and Syria over the weekend, with eight strikes reported in Syria and four more in Iraq.
According to U.S. Central Command, the latest strikes were conducted using attack planes, fighter jets and remotely piloted aircraft. The strikes in Syria destroyed a tank, three armed vehicles and a Humvee and damaged another tank, oil refineries and a command and control node operated by the Islamic State of Iraq and Syria.
The strikes in Iraq destroyed an ISIS safe house, two checkpoints and a transport vehicle and damaged another checkpoint.
